Types of water heaters commonly installed in Conway

In Conway, homeowners have various options when it comes to water heater installation. Our network of Conway water heater specialists can install different types of water heaters, including:

1. Traditional tank water heaters

Tank water heaters are the most common type found in Conway homes. These systems store hot water in a tank and continuously heat it to maintain a set temperature. Our network of Conway water heater installation companies can efficiently install traditional tank water heaters, ensuring proper sizing and placement for optimal performance.

2. Tankless water heaters

Tankless water heaters, also known as on-demand water heaters, heat water directly as it passes through the unit, eliminating the need for a storage tank. These systems offer energy efficiency and unlimited hot water supply, making them a popular choice among Conway homeowners. Our water heater experts in Conway, South Carolina, can help you determine if a tankless water heater is the right choice for your home and handle the installation process seamlessly.

3. Heat pump water heaters

Heat pump water heaters use electricity to move heat from one place to another instead of generating heat directly. These systems are highly efficient, making them an excellent option for homeowners in Conway looking to reduce energy consumption. Our network of Conway water heater professionals can install heat pump water heaters with precision, ensuring optimal performance and energy savings for your home.

Frequently Asked Questions About Water Heater Repair in Conway, South Carolina

What are the common signs that indicate my water heater needs repair?

Common signs of water heater issues include lack of hot water, strange noises coming from the unit, water leaks, discolored or foul-smelling water, and inconsistent water temperature.

How often should I have my water heater serviced?

It's recommended to have your water heater serviced annually to ensure it's functioning properly and to catch any potential issues early on. Regular maintenance can help prolong the lifespan of your water heater and prevent costly repairs.

Can I repair my water heater myself?

While some minor repairs can be done DIY, it's generally not recommended to attempt major repairs on your own. Water heaters involve complex systems and can be dangerous if mishandled. It's best to leave repairs to qualified professionals.

How long does water heater repair typically take?

The duration of water heater repairs can vary depending on the nature of the issue and the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may be completed within a few hours, while more complex problems could take longer to resolve.

What factors can affect the cost of water heater repair?

The cost of water heater repair can be influenced by factors such as the type of repair needed, the age and condition of the water heater, the availability of replacement parts, and the rates charged by the repair technician.

Is it better to repair or replace a malfunctioning water heater?

In some cases, repairing a water heater may be more cost-effective than replacing it, especially if the issue is minor and the unit is relatively new. However, if the water heater is old or experiencing frequent problems, replacement may be a better long-term solution.

What should I do if my water heater is leaking?

If your water heater is leaking, it's important to shut off the power and water supply to the unit to prevent further damage. Then, contact a professional water heater repair service in Conway immediately to assess the situation and make necessary repairs.

Can water heater repair specialists in Conway handle emergencies?

Yes, many water heater repair specialists in Conway offer emergency services to address urgent issues such as sudden breakdowns or leaks. These professionals are available 24/7 to provide prompt assistance and ensure your safety and comfort.

What precautions should I take to prevent water heater problems?

To prevent water heater problems, it's important to perform regular maintenance, such as flushing the tank to remove sediment buildup, checking for leaks or corrosion, and monitoring the temperature and pressure settings. Additionally, be mindful of any unusual noises or changes in performance, as these could indicate underlying issues.
